Physical functioning refers to the ability perform daily living activities, namely basic instrumental, and advanced activities. Poorer performance in these areas may indicate potential presence of sarcopenia. To analyze differences physical function between older people with without sarcopenia investigate associations tests A cross-sectional study based on data from Northern region Brazil year 2018 was conducted. Study participants included 312 aged ≥ 60 years (64.1% female). Sarcopenia defined using updated criteria European Working Group Older People (EWGSOP2). measured functional fitness (30-second chair stand test, sit-and-reach 8-foot Up-and-Go Test, 6-minute walk 4-meter gait speed, Fullerton Advanced Balance Scale). Confirmed detected 29.2% participants, but no participant had severe Most parameters crude analysis were associated confirmed (all p < 0.05), except for back scratch test. In a model adjusted sex, age body mass index, slower speed (OR = 1.29, 95%CI 1.08 1.54), up-and-go test time 1.32, 1.16 1.49), greater 0.97, 0.94 0.99) higher self-reported Composite Function scores 0.94, 0.89 significantly status. EWGSOP2 is prevalent residing Brazil's independently walking rising ability, reduced trunk lower-limb flexibility, as well poorer function.

Abstract: This article focuses on a range of non-pharmacological strategies for managing sarcopenia in chronic diseases, including exercise, dietary supplements, traditional Chinese intestinal microecology, and rehabilitation therapies individuals with limited limb movement. By analyzing multiple studies, the aims to summarize available evidence manage diseases. The results strongly emphasize role resistance training addressing diseases secondary sarcopenia. Maintaining appropriate frequency intensity can help prevent muscle atrophy effectively reduce inflammation. Although aerobic exercise has ability improve skeletal mass, it does have some positive effects physical function. Building upon this, explores potential benefits combined approaches, highlighting their helpfulness overall quality life. Additionally, also highlights importance supplements combating It protein intake, rich essential amino acids omega-3, as well sufficient vitamin D atrophy. Combining appears be an effective strategy preventing sarcopenia, although optimal dosage type supplement remain unclear. Furthermore, microecology Probiotics, prebiotics, bacterial products are suggested new treatment options emerging such whole body vibration training, blood flow restriction, electrical stimulation show promise treating Overall, this provides valuable insights into emphasizes holistic integrated approach that incorporates nutrition, multidisciplinary interventions, which promote health elderly population. Future research should prioritize high-quality randomized controlled trials utilize wearable devices, smartphone applications, other advanced surveillance methods investigate most intervention associated different Keywords: disease, inflammation

Abstract Background This study aimed to explore the prevalence and related risk factors of sarcopenia in patients on maintenance hemodialysis (MHD). Methods cohort enrolled 165 MHD. The were divided into non-sarcopenia groups based presence or not. Sarcopenia was diagnosed according consensus Asian Working Group that considers reduced muscle mass decreased strength (19). measured using multi-frequency bioelectrical impedance (Inbody260) skeletal index (SMI) used: <7.0 kg/m 2 (male); <5.7 (female) - with reduction. electronic grip dynamometer used for measuring dominant handgrip (HGS) reflect strength. Male HGS < 28 kg female 18 considered a decrease demographic characteristics, laboratory indexes, anthropometrical measurements, body compositions, InBody score compared between groups. multivariate logistic regression sarcopenia. Results Of MHD, 36 had sarcopenia, 21.82%. Patients group higher ages lower index, serum albumin level, circumference waist, hip, biceps, strength, total water content, protein inorganic salt concentrations, mass, basal metabolic rate, obesity degree, SMI, fat content. showed age, waist circumference, influencing hemodialysis. Conclusion high Higher independent such patients.
